What is the housing profile of Vale of White Horse?

Vale of White Horse has a Gera Housing Stock Profile (GHSP) of 81/100 from ONS Census 2021 (+7 points above the national average of 74/100). 67.3% of its 57,498 households occupy detached or semi-detached houses, 73.4% use mains gas heating, and 1.6% are overcrowded by bedroom standard. Source: ONS Census 2021 Tables TS044–TS052 (OGL v3.0), census day 21 March 2021.

What percentage of homes in Vale of White Horse are detached or semi-detached?

According to ONS Census 2021 (Table TS044), 67.3% of the 57,498 households in Vale of White Horse occupy detached (36.8%) or semi-detached (30.5%) properties. Terraced houses account for 18.1% and purpose-built flats for 11.1%. Source: ONS Census 2021, OGL v3.0.

What type of central heating do homes in Vale of White Horse use?

Per ONS Census 2021 (Table TS046), 73.4% of households in Vale of White Horse use mains gas as their sole central heating source. Electric-only heating accounts for 8.3%, oil-only for 5.7%, and 0.9% of households have no central heating. Source: ONS Census 2021, OGL v3.0.

Is there overcrowding in Vale of White Horse?

The ONS bedroom standard defines overcrowding as a household having one or fewer bedrooms than required. In Vale of White Horse, 1.6% of households were overcrowded at Census Day 21 March 2021. By contrast, 78% were under-occupied (one or more spare bedrooms). Source: ONS Census 2021, Table TS052, OGL v3.0.

How many households in Vale of White Horse have no car?

According to ONS Census 2021 (Table TS045), 12.2% of households in Vale of White Horse have no car or van. 39.8% have one car, 35.2% have two cars, and 12.8% have three or more. Source: ONS Census 2021, OGL v3.0.

What is the Gera Housing Stock Profile (GHSP)?

The Gera Housing Stock Profile (GHSP) is a 0–100 index computed from four ONS Census 2021 Topic Summary tables (TS044 accommodation type, TS045 car availability, TS046 central heating, TS052 bedroom occupancy rating). Formula: GHSP = 0.30 × (detached+semi)% + 0.25 × (100 − overcrowded%) + 0.25 × mains-gas% + 0.20 × (100 − no-car%). A higher score indicates a local authority with more spacious housing, lower overcrowding, stronger mains-gas connection, and higher car availability. National England & Wales baseline: 74/100.
